This research explores how memories are formed and modified after learning, focusing on the role of synaptic plasticity in the brain. It aims to uncover the mechanisms that influence memory retention and consolidation over time.
Nervous systems produce adaptive behavior, arguably their most important function, through learning and memory.
Memories ensure that what is learned will be available for later retrieval.
Upon the initial learning process, synaptic plasticity important for memory consolidation is triggered within minutes, but whether, and in which form memories will be retained more permanently can be influenced by information and insights gained after the initial trigger.
